I have no forage fish in my female only perch pond and they also back off on the pellets -- especially the larger ones. So I wouldn't be too concerned if you have plenty of forage fish.

The bright side is less money spent on feed right?

Come spring my 13 to 14 inch female yellow perch look healthy with large ovaries so apparently they are feeding in something. My guess is the abundance snails and other invertebrates, although the .62 acre pond has around 300 large female yellow perch and about 100 large male bluegill.
